searchview_customecell
全部标签 我是android的新手,我被困在一些我认为很简单但我很困惑的事情上..我需要在我的Relativelayout中而不是在操作栏/工具栏中创建自定义searchView。问题是我不知道如何自定义背景、文本输入颜色、XML中的搜索图标颜色,或者只是它们的属性。目前我正在使用手机,无法显示我的代码。有人告诉我如何自定义它吗?也许向我展示任何我可以遵循的教程?提前致谢!!!! 最佳答案 将此代码添加到您的RelativeLayout-不要忘记更改这些图标。然后关注这个SearchView了解SearchView的每个选项。
我在Fragment调用的上下文操作栏中的SearchView遇到了一些问题。最主要的是,当我的SearchView展开时,即使有一些未使用的空间,它也会使操作栏中的所有其他项目(关闭按钮除外)消失,就像您在这个屏幕截图中看到的那样:此外,我在这个问题中也遇到了同样的问题:ActionBaralwaysexpandedSearchViewwiththeiconinside这是我的SearchView的XML代码:这是实现ActionMode.Callback的Fragment的JAVA代码@OverridepublicbooleanonCreateActionMode(ActionMo
我有一个针对api11及更高版本的项目,所以没有actionbarsherlock。我正在使用SearchView开始一项Activity。我想立即关注SearchView,并打开软键盘(如果没有硬件键盘)。我试过:mSearchView.requestFocus();mSearchView.requestFocusFromTouch();这实际上聚焦于搜索View,但它不显示键盘。我已经阅读了其他帖子,说它有效。其他帖子尝试使用以下方式强制键盘启动:InputMethodManagerimm=(InputMethodManager)getSystemService(Context.I
非常简单的问题,不需要太多代码:我正在使用Android的默认ActionBar(没有Sherlock),其中有几个MenuItem。其中之一是用于典型搜索场景的可折叠操作View(android:showAsAction="collapseActionView|always"):用户单击图标→搜索框展开→当用户在QueryTextChange上键入任何内容时它的魔力)。SearchViewsv=newSearchView(this);sv.setLayoutParams(newActionBar.LayoutParams(Gravity.RIGHT));//Yada,yada...s
我对CollapsingToolbarLayout标题与SearchView文本的重叠问题不大。CollapsingToolbarLayout展开的时候没有问题:但是当折叠时,文本重叠:如何解决? 最佳答案 我尝试了Tomas的答案,但它有一个问题,即一旦用户滚动,应用栏就会再次折叠,问题再次出现。所以我想到了另一种解决方案,即在展开搜索View时使折叠的标题文本透明。这很好用,并且不依赖于或更改应用栏的折叠/展开状态。就是这样:if(searchViewExpanding){collapsingToolbarLayout.setC
我在Android开发者上使用我的Searchview时遇到了麻烦。我正在尝试在我的工具栏应用程序上实现搜索View。目前它运行良好,但当我旋转设备时,搜索View的行为很奇怪。我的目标是保留查询文本,因此在“OnCreateOptionsMenu”上@OverridepublicvoidonCreateOptionsMenu(Menumenu,MenuInflaterinflater){inflater.inflate(R.menu.menu_funcionarios_toolbar,menu);clearSearchItem=menu.findItem(R.id.botao_lim
编辑对于任何想知道的人,我的问题是我使用的是android.widget.SearchView而不是android.support.v7.widget.SearchView。我希望这可以帮助其他遇到同样问题的人!原帖我正尝试按照官方指南在AndroidActionBar中实现SearchView:http://developer.android.com/training/search/setup.html在没有找到问题之后,我终于剥离到最基本的HelloWorld应用程序,令我惊讶的是,这个错误仍然存在于一个最小的应用程序中!这是错误:搜索图标出现在菜单栏中,没问题。当我单击它时,
我已经实现了搜索View,它可以过滤我的ListView项目。当我输入任何文本时,它会过滤列表,但当我退出搜索View时,它不会返回原始列表项。publicclassPlacesListAdapterextendsArrayAdapterimplementsFilterable{publicContextcontext;privateListplaces,orig,itemDetailsrrayList;privatePlaceFilterfilter;publicPlacesListAdapter(Contextcontext,inttextViewResourceId){super
我的SearchView显示如下:如您所见,SearchView的search_edit_frame和SearchView本身之外都有一个边距。这是从哪里来的?检查布局会发现search_edit_frame左侧有24像素的边距,但其他地方没有边距。如何删除这个多余的空间?菜单.xml:布局:(...)我设法通过应用@Jimmy的回答来减少间距:但是“后退”图像按钮和SearchView之间仍然存在很大差距。 最佳答案 search_edit_frame是searchview布局中的LinearLayout。默认情况下,它的开始和结
我想在我的应用程序中实现搜索,但我不想使用单独的Activity来显示我的搜索结果。相反,我只想使用显示在SearchView下方的建议列表。.我可以使用setOnQueryTextListener在SearchView上,监听输入并搜索结果。但是我怎样才能将这些结果添加到SearchView下面的列表中呢??假设我正在搜索List. 最佳答案 您需要创建一个ContentProvider.通过这种方式,您可以将自定义结果添加到您的SearchView,并在用户输入内容时为其添加自动完成功能。如果我没记错的话,在我的一个项目中我做过